Eagles advance to Area round of playoffs

Body

In a season that continues to impress, the 2025 Canton Eagle varsity football team became a part of school history as they opened their post-season run with a 20-7 bi-district round victory over the Caddo Mills Foxes Nov. 14 at Royse City. Coach Heath Ragle’s Eagles, 10-1 overall, became the fifth team in Canton football history to achieve at least a 10-win season. The win over Caddo Mills earns the Eagles an opportunity to compete in the Class 4A, District 2, Area championship contest when they travel to Texarkana Pleasant Grove for a 6:30 p.m. kickoff Friday, Nov. 14.

Eaglettes start basketball season strong

Body
The Canton Eaglettes’ varsity basketball team went undefeated in pre-season scrimmages with Caddo Mills, LaPoyner, and Van Alstyne, in addition to playing their home opener against Rains recently. The four returning seniors had a great showing with a very strong supporting bench.
